The mirror of fire and dreaming

Anand's mentor and spiritual guide, the Master Healer Abhaydatta, seems to be in grave danger. Should he simply convey this information to his elders and waste precious time or should he take matters into his own hands? Readers familiar with Anand from Chitra Banerjee Divakaruni's acclaimed novel, The conch bearer, will know what choice he makes. In doing so, he embarks on a spectacular adventure that takes him not only across contemporary India but also several hundred years into the past, to Bengal in the time of the Muslim nawabs, where he encounters powerful sorcerers, a haughty and arrogant young prince, and a jinn capable of unspeakable evil. Joining him is his old friend Nisha, in this world transformed into a young lady of noble birth. Chitra Banerjee Divakaruni once again weaves a vibrant tapestry of action, suspense, and rare beauty. Fans of her work, as well as new listeners, will be entranced.
